Solar Submersible Pump - Water Leakage Testing

In the manufacturing process of solar submersible pumps, one of the most critical quality control steps is water leakage testing. This procedure decide whether this solar pump works or not. Given that these pumps operate fully submerged in water—often in deep wells or water tanks—it is crucial that every unit is tested thoroughly before leaving the factory. At Leap Pump, every unit of solar submersible pump undergoes rigorous water leakage testing to ensure the highest level of quality and durability. This critical step in the production process is designed to identify any potential points of water ingress that could compromise the pump’s performance or lifespan. Each pump is either pressure-tested or fully submerged in water for a specific duration, during which technicians carefully inspect for any signs of leakage at key areas such as cable entry points, motor housing seals, and shaft assemblies.
